So a fabricator made a PQR based on these parameters:
T = 50 mm
GTAW t (root) = 8 mm
SMAW t (middle passes) = 21 mm
SAW t (subsequent passes plus cap) = 21 mm
The PQR above is used to support a WPS with SMAW only and T and t ranges of 8 mm to 200 mm. (The WPS stated backing is required but this point is moot in this discussion.)
I don't see any problem with this and my opinion is that this in compliance of the Code.
Thoughts, anyone?
